Bilateral pulvinar sign on T2 MRI scans for nvCJD
There is a need to diagnose new variant Creutzfeldt-Jakob disease (vCJD) non-invasively. This study investigated the specificity and sensitivity of pulvinar high signal on T2 MRI brain scans of patients with suspected vCJD.
